Coa Xorete is a turbo-charged party anthem where rapper Lucky Brown teams up with Big Cvyu to celebrate street swagger, Chilean slang and non-stop dancing. The title mixes the word coa – Chile’s gritty prison-born dialect – with xorete – a playful way of saying “cool” or “fresh.” From the very first “pon-pon-pon” the track invites everyone to hit the dance floor, bounce their bodies and let the bass shake the room.

Beneath the contagious hooks and tongue-twisting ad-libs, the lyrics paint a picture of nightlife bravado: flashing cash, lighting up a smoke, and commanding attention with bold moves. Lines like “Yo te rescaté” (I rescued you) and “rebótame ese culote” (bounce that backside for me) show Lucky Brown playing the confident host who pulls the crowd into his orbit. It’s all about liberation and attitude – flaite (street) style, fast money, and the thrill of owning the club for one explosive night. The result is a track that fuses U.S. rap energy with Latin urban flavor, urging listeners to loosen up, show off and keep the party lit till sunrise.
